8082. Ring out the name of Jesus

1 Ring out the name of Jesus,
Let all the people know
’Tis Christ, our Lord and Savior,
Who overcomes the foe.
We follow at His bidding,
We trust in Him alone,
And lift our loud hosannas
To Him upon the throne.

2 We lift His blood stained banner,
His precious name we bear,
And pressing to the conflict,
The Gospel armor wear.
The shield of faith we carry,
In battling for the right,
His Word of truth our weapon,
His strength our only might.

3 He knows the dangers round us,
He knows the hidden snare;
Wherever He shall lead us,
Is safety, only there.
The power of His salvation
Our joyful song shall be;
We’ll watch and work for Jesus,
His servants glad and free.

Text Information
First Line: Ring out the name of Jesus
Author: Eliza E. Hewitt
Meter: 76.76 D
Language: English
Source: Bible Study Songs, by Bertha F. Vella and Daniel. B. Towner (Boston: The Pilgrim Press, 1899)
Copyright: Public Domain
Notes: Alternate tune: WEBB by George J. Webb, 1830
Tune Information
Name: MYRTLE BEACH
Composer: Daniel Brink Towner (1890)
Meter: 76.76 D
Key: A Major
Copyright: Public Domain
